Understanding Termite Heat Treatment

Termite heat treatment is a sustainable alternative to traditional chemical-based pest control. It involves raising the temperature within the infested structure to a level that is lethal to termites, typically between 120°F and 140°F. By exposing the termites to high heat for a specific duration, the method effectively eradicates the infestation.

How It Works

During a termite heat treatment, specialized equipment is used to generate and circulate heated air throughout the targeted area. This process can be carefully controlled to ensure that all affected areas reach the required temperature, leaving no refuge for the termites. The entire treatment typically lasts for several hours, depending on the size and severity of the infestation.

Thermal imaging technology may also be employed to monitor and confirm the uniform distribution of heat, ensuring that all sections of the structure are effectively treated. This precision makes termite heat treatment an efficient and thorough method of pest control.

Benefits of Termite Heat Treatment

1. Eco-Friendly: Unlike chemical pesticides, termite heat treatment poses no threat to the environment, making it a sustainable choice for pest control.

2. Non-Toxic: With no harmful chemicals involved, termite heat treatment is safe for residents, pets, and the surrounding ecosystem.

3. Comprehensive Eradication: The elevated temperatures eliminate termites at all life stages, including eggs, larvae, and adult insects, providing a thorough and long-lasting solution.

4. Structural Preservation: Heat treatment can also help to dry out and eliminate excess moisture in the treated areas, contributing to the preservation of the structure.
